JOB SUMMARY:

The Painter Helper should be available to provide assistance and support to trained and experienced professional painters and work under their direction and supervision. They will be responsible for tasks such as preparing the location for painting, organizing supplies and other painting tasks as instructed. The ideal candidate is a quick learner and can receive and recall verbal instructions in English. Physical capacity to perform all assigned work is a must as the position is labour intensive and may involve heavy lifting, repetitive motions, and safe use of equipment.

JOB DESCRIPTION AND DUTIES:

  • Assist professional painters with various painting related tasks.
  • Load and unload painting supplies, required tools, and equipment, and transport them to and from work areas.
  • Prepare work areas by erecting and dismantling ladders, scaffolding, and barricades required for painting jobs.
  • Mix, pour and spread paint, primer, varnish, wax, and other materials as needed.
  • Support painters by sanding, scraping, or cleaning surfaces to ensure proper adhesion of paint.
  • Mask and cover furniture, floors, and non-paintable surfaces to protect them during painting operations.
  • Assist those operating heavy equipment in moving, setting up and taking down the equipment.
  • Safely operate power tools such as sanders, paint pumps, test and measuring devices.
  • Clean paintbrushes and rollers used for painting.
  • Clean job site and equipment used once the work is finished.
  • Remove and safely store hazardous materials.
  • Remove remains and other debris at painting sites using scrappers and other equipment.
  • Perform other activities at painting sites, as directed.
  • Apply paint or other materials, such as stains, lacquer, enamel, oil, varnish, etc. using brushes, rollers or spray equipment.
